jetdv wrote on 7/7/2022, 5:40 PM

@Roger Bansemer, also, when installing, you only need to select the "OpenFX 64-bit" option. The other three are not needed in current versions of VEGAS. The two without "64-bit" are 32-bit versions so they won't work unless you're installing Vegas Pro 8 or older (version 8.1 was the first 64-bit version). The other one is the "DirectX" version required by versions older than 10 (OFX was first in version 10).
